Output 71d1f5b6ce266416455a61c2719b97e39cc1d44ae7e521afc8ffc762148afdcf:50

value
784099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6d42e1e10ab3e5c4f34fe386318dd612b69607d OP_EQUAL
address
3JMj5zV2Su8ce2f7gipcBM6KtUp5ExBJWn
transaction
71d1f5b6ce266416455a61c2719b97e39cc1d44ae7e521afc8ffc762148afdcf
spent
true